The Ankara Chief Public Prosecutor's Office announced that a detention order was issued for 3 suspects and a judicial control decision for 1 suspect as part of the investigation into the harassment allegations in the Turkish Grand National Assembly. The number of detainees in the investigation has risen to 4.
The investigation into the harassment allegations in the Turkish Grand National Assembly (TBMM) is ongoing. A student named D.K., who is interning at TBMM during the 2024-2025 academic year, applied to the Ankara Provincial Police Department's Child Branch on December 4.

The student claimed that H.İ.G., who works at the Assembly cafeteria, sexually harassed her. As part of the initiated investigation, D.K. gave her statement at the Child Monitoring Center. The suspect H.İ.G. was detained on December 10 and was arrested by the Ankara 5th Criminal Court of Peace for the crime of 'sexual harassment against a child' the day before yesterday.

As the investigation deepened with the examination of the administrative investigation documents sent by the TBMM General Secretariat, the statements of three other victims, who were also found to be victims of similar incidents in D.K.'s statement and the administrative investigation documents, were taken at the Child Monitoring Center. Four other suspects, who are also accused of sexually harassing the victims, were detained yesterday.

According to a statement from the Ankara Chief Public Prosecutor's Office; after their procedures at the police, the suspects R.Ç. was placed under judicial control, while D.U., R.S., and İ.B. were issued arrest warrants for the crime of 'sexual harassment.' The investigation related to the incident is ongoing.
